Water, ice, meteorological, and speed measurements at South Cascade Glacier, Washington, 1999 balance year Water, ice, meteorological, and speed measurements at South Cascade Glacier, Washington, 1999 balance year

Winter snow accumulation and summer snow, firn, and ice melt were measured at South Cascade Glacier, Washington, to determine the winter and net balances for the 1999 balance year. The 1999 winter snow balance, averaged over the glacier, was 3.59 meters, and the net balance was 1.02 meters. Since the winter balance record began in 1959, only three winters have had a higher winter balance...

Microbiological quality of Puget Sound Basin streams and identification of contaminant sources Microbiological quality of Puget Sound Basin streams and identification of contaminant sources

Fecal coliforms, Escherichia coli, enterococci, and somatic coliphages were detected in samples from 31 sites on streams draining urban and agricultural regions of the Puget Sound Basin Lowlands. Densities of bacteria in 48 and 71 percent of the samples exceeded U.S. Environmental Protection Agency's freshwater recreation criteria for Escherichia coli and enterococci, respectively, and...
